Strike set to be called off
By Stuff.co.nz
Published: 06/01/2007

NEW ZEALAND - Prison unit managers are being recommend to pull the pin on strike action over a claimed $4500 pay cut. The managers had planned to take the action from June 7, refusing overtime, on-call work outside normal hours, and taking work-related phone calls outside work.

At the heart of the dispute is a $4500 "muster allowance", which was paid to compensate the managers for prison numbers being increased past previously agreed levels. Read more.
